Adult Male Bed Bug Click on image to enlarge Adult Female Bed Bug Click on image to enlarge Bed Bug Nymph Click on image to enlarge The common bed bug is visible to the naked eye. Adult bed bugs are brown to reddish-brown, oval-shaped, flattened, and about 1/4 to 5/8 inch long. Their flat shape enables them to readily hide in cracks and crevices.
After a blood meal, the body elongates and becomes swollen. Eggs are not known to be placed on the host's body but are found on surfaces near where the host sleeps. Bed bugs have a beak- like piercing , sucking mouthparts.
The adults have small, stubby, nonfunctional wing pads. Newly hatched nymphs are nearly colorless, becoming brownish as they mature. Nymphs have the general appearance of adults.
Eggs are white and about 1/32 inch long. More.
